WebThere are three phases of the low FODMAP diet: 1) Elimination, 2) Reintroduction, and 3) Personalization. During the elimination phase, which lasts 2-4 weeks, all FODMAPs are taken out of the diet. If symptoms are significantly improved with the elimination phase, patients will start the reintroduction phase, where groups of FODMAPs are added ... WebA low FODMAP diet should only be used by people who have been diagnosed with IBS by a doctor. It is an elimination diet used to help find which foods cause IBS symptoms. Here is how the diet works: You will stop eating all foods that are high in FODMAPs. (Below see the list of some high-FODMAP foods.) It supports muscle growth and replenishes depleted glycogen stores after intense exercise. peter browne vegemite paintings for saleWeb24 mrt. 2024 · Most coffee is not high in FODMAPs, so it is not considered off-limits when beginning the elimination phase. However, chicory root based coffees should be avoided for FODMAP reasons.
